Algae shows the ability in a standard engine. Algaeus has begun its drive across America: the trip is started from San Francisco September 8 and will take 10 days to make it to Washington, DC. The first algae-fueled vehicle called the Algaeus is promoted from group responsible , the Veggie Van Organization, expects the car will only in need of 25 gallons of fuel to finish the entire journey..
